NATURAL DISASTERS
- Major Natural Disasters Affecting Our
Country: Our country faces various natural disasters, each with its unique
set of challenges. Let's examine some of the most significant ones and
their consequences:
- Earthquakes: Our region is located in a
seismically active zone, making it prone to earthquakes. These seismic
events can lead to infrastructure damage, injuries, and casualties.
- Floods: Heavy rainfall or the overflow of
rivers can result in devastating floods, causing destruction of homes,
infrastructure, and loss of crops. Floods also pose risks of waterborne
diseases and displacement of communities.
- Wildfires: Dry weather conditions and
human activities can ignite destructive wildfires, destroying vast areas
of forests, wildlife habitats, and posing health risks due to air
pollution.
- Hurricanes: Our coastal areas are
vulnerable to hurricanes, which bring strong winds, storm surges, and
heavy rainfall. These events can cause widespread property damage,
flooding, and displacement of communities.
- Landslides: Steep terrains in certain
regions are prone to landslides during heavy rainfall or seismic activity.
Landslides pose risks to human lives, damage infrastructure, and can block
transportation routes.
- Pandemic: Covid-19 Instructions and Guidelines:
The Covid-19 pandemic, caused by the SARS-CoV-2 virus, has presented an
unprecedented global health crisis. Here are five affirmative and five
negative sentences summarizing the instructions given by experts worldwide
to mitigate the spread of the virus.
Affirmative Sentences:
- Health authorities advised people to
frequently wash their hands with soap and water for at least 20 seconds.
- Experts encouraged individuals to wear
face masks or face coverings in public settings where social distancing is
challenging.
- They emphasized the importance of
practicing social distancing by maintaining a minimum distance of six feet
from others.
- Health organizations recommended covering
the mouth and nose with a tissue or elbow when coughing or sneezing to
prevent the spread of respiratory droplets.
- Experts advised people to stay home if
they exhibited any symptoms of Covid-19 and seek medical assistance.
Negative Sentences:
- It was advised not to touch the face,
particularly the eyes, nose, or mouth, as it could facilitate the entry of
the virus into the body.
- Health authorities discouraged attending
large gatherings, including parties, concerts, and sporting events, to
minimize the risk of virus transmission.
- They urged individuals not to travel
unnecessarily, especially to areas with high infection rates or during
widespread outbreaks.
- It was recommended not to share personal
items like utensils, towels, or drinks with others to avoid potential
virus transmission.
